[0026] The technical scheme of the present invention is described in further detail below in conjunction with accompanying drawing and example: A1) by initialization module, the initial value (also called seed) of pseudo-random bit generator is expanded and produces the initial value of coupling chaotic mapping system; A2) expands The initial value of the generated coupled chaotic mapping system is input into the coupled chaotic mapping system, and through the action of the coupled chaotic mapping system, multiple chaotic sequences are output in parallel, chaotic sequence rounding output bit sequence.
[0027] In A1, the initialization module is to expand the initial value of 64 bits to 32N bits through nonlinear transformation, and generate N initial values x of the coupled chaotic mapping system 0 (i), N is the number of coupling maps, N≥4, each x 0 (i) belong to [0, 2 32 ) integers on the interval.
